The textures on the Procedural Crowds models appear black; how can I fix this?

This issue may arise if you are using an outdated version of Blender; the feature should work correctly from version 3.4 onwards. Additionally, the problem might be related to the asset folder path. Try moving the folder to your local hard drive. When the Assets folder is stored on a cloud-based drive, it can cause problems.

Is Procedural Crowds compatible with Blender 4.0?

Yes, Procedural Crowds is currently compatible with Blender version 4.0. However, there is a known issue caused by Blender in the "Random Walk" crowd type, which has been resolved in Blender version 4.0.2.

Can I export the crowds to other 3D software?

We cannot provide a 100% effective method for this process. Procedural Crowds was originally designed to work within Blender with the tools it provides.

In which Blender versions does Procedural Crowds work?

Procedural Crowds currently works in Blender from 3.4 to 4.0.2. We will continue to work on making it compatible with future versions of Blender as well.
